inset.exporter <-
function(x, xlab = deparse(substitute(x)), log = FALSE, xlim = NULL, nclass = NULL,
ifnright = TRUE, file = NULL, table.cex = 0.7, gtype = "emf" , ...)
{
# Wrapper to save the graphics output from a run of inset.
#
# NOTE: This functionality is only available under the Windows OS.
#
# To function correctly the data frame containing the data must be attached
# prior to running this function, if it has not already been done so, i.e.
# attach(dfname), and at close it should be detached if necesary, detach(dfname).
#
# NOTE: Prior to using this function the data frame/matrix containing the
# variable, 'x', data must be run through ltdl.fix.df to convert any <dl
# -ve values to positive half that value, and set zero2na = TRUE if it is
# required to convert any zero values or other numeric codes representing
# blanks to NAs.
#
info <- Sys.info()
if(!info[1] == "Windows") stop("\n This function only available under the Windows OS\n")
##
dfname <- search()[[2]]
xname <- deparse(substitute(x))
if (is.null(file)) {
file <- getwd()
cat(" By default the output file will be saved in the R working directory as:\n",
" \"dataframename_inset_xname.emf\"\n",
" To specify an alternate location and file name prefix, to which:\n",
" \"dfname_inset_xname.emf\" will be appended, set, for example:\n",
" file = \"D://R_work//Project3\"\n\n")
}
file.name <- paste(file, "/", dfname, "_inset_", xname, ".", gtype, sep = "")
cat(" Graphics file will be saved as:", file.name, "\n\n")
##
inset(x, xlab = xlab, log = log, xlim = xlim, nclass = nclass, ifnright = ifnright,
table.cex = table.cex, ...)
savePlot(filename = file.name, type = gtype)
invisible()
}
